§ 10A-9A-1.04 — Nature and Purpose

Text
(a)A limited partnership is a separate legal entity. A limited partnership’s status for tax purposes shall not affect its status as a separate legal entity formed under this chapter. A limited partnership is the same entity regardless of whether its certificate of formation states that the limited partnership is a limited liability limited partnership. A partner has no interest in any specific property of a limited partnership.
(b)A limited partnership may carry on any lawful activity, whether or not for profit, except a banking or insurance business.
